Transaction 62d9519fc8f1ec7875ff941c8dc12fbfae1e1f07aa18ce89a2fde1350f88eab2

2 Input
2 Outputs
  • 62d9519fc8f1ec7875ff941c8dc12fbfae1e1f07aa18ce89a2fde1350f88eab2:0
  • value  130584
    address  33cPj1cQN96L8D1jp7hpR5wBwDguS8PfYJ
  • 62d9519fc8f1ec7875ff941c8dc12fbfae1e1f07aa18ce89a2fde1350f88eab2:1
  • value  600815
    address  3EMRuKd2FqAphwtJdfnwcgeUiLN3VjxFC6